film roll keychain

We will search for you based on popular search keywords and website keywords

Understand your competitors' SEO profile

film roll keychain

print your face or face of your family, friend or pet on these exclusive and super cosy socks! pets socks for pet lovers, love socks for your beloved ones - myphotosocksau are designed to make your dearest ones smile! handmade products shop online‎! lots of customized products for you with quality guarantee!
Category:groceries Global Rank:1,924,873 visits:16.1K pages/Per:2.6
ADS